Due to our continued success and increasing workloads, we currently have vacancies for Painters and Decorators for our Ellesmere Port (North West) branch!
Bagnalls is a well-established and highly respectable painting and decorating contractor with an impressive customer portfolio. We are a company that has a proud heritage, with over 150 years of continuous service.

How to prepare for a job interview at Bagnalls
✨Know Your Craft
Make sure you brush up on your painting and decorating skills before the interview. Be ready to discuss your techniques, tools, and any special projects you've worked on. This shows your passion and expertise in the field.
✨Showcase Your Experience
Prepare a portfolio of your previous work, including photos of completed projects. This visual evidence can really impress the interviewers at Bagnalls and demonstrate your ability to deliver high-quality results.
✨Understand the Company
Do a bit of research on Bagnalls and their history. Knowing about their 150 years of service and impressive customer portfolio will help you align your answers with their values and show that you're genuinely interested in being part of their team.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
Prepare some questions to ask during the interview. Inquire about their current projects or what they value most in a Painter/Decorator. This not only shows your interest but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
